Excelのコメントを他のシートに書き出したいと考えてします。
一行だけ抽出するのは以下で出来ているのですが
ある程度の範囲(例えばJ15:AN232)を一括で抽出するには
どのようにすればいいでしょうか。
Sub コメント抽出()
Const C As Integer = 5 Const D As Integer = 9 Dim FR As Variant Dim LR As Variant Dim R As Variant FR = 3 LR = 300 Application.ScreenUpdating = False Application.Calculation = xlCalculationManual For R = FR To LR Cells(R, D).Value = Cells(R, C).NoteText Next R ActiveSheet.Range("A1").AutoFilter Field:=9, Criteria1:="<>" MsgBox "抽出しました" Application.ScreenUpdating = Ture Application.Calculation = xlCalculationAutomatic
End Sub
ご教授よろしくお願い致します。
抽出先はどこになりますか?現状のコードでは5列目を対象に9列目に書き出しているようですが。
ありがとうございます。
別のシート(例えばシート名が「抽出」)の任意の範囲にしたいと考えています。
回答2件
あなたの回答
tips
プレビュー